Denmark-based Gram Equipment company, which is the strongest player in the global market in the production of ice cream mass production machines, opened its new facility in the Aegean Free Zone. Gram Equipment, which is the leader in its sector with its 34 percent share in the global market, aims to grow by 1 percent at the end of the year with the new facility it has put into service with an investment of 45 million dollars. With the new facility, the number of employees of the company increased to 110 people.

The opening ceremony held at the company's new production facility in the Aegean Free Zone was attended by Danish Ambassador to Ankara Danny Annan, Aegean Free Zone Manager Mevlüde Şenay Satoğlu, Industry and Technology İzmir Provincial Manager Engin Bişar, ESBAŞ Executive Board Chairman Faruk Güler, Gram Equipment Executive Board Chairman Tom Wrensted, Gram Equipment Turkey General Manager Özgür Seyhan and many guests and company employees attended.

Speaking at the ceremony, Gram Equipment Executive Board Chairman Tom Wrensted said he was happy to open such a facility during the pandemic period. Emphasizing that the company showed the greatest performance in its history by getting stronger in 2020, Wrensted stated that they will break a new record in 2021 despite the Corona pandemic, and said, “We have made a great breakthrough in the last 2 years and we are on our way successfully. We have created our 2023 strategy. Accordingly, we have an ambitious growth target. Gram Turkey will also need to grow in terms of capacity in the coming years.

Özgür Seyhan, General Manager of Gram Equipment Turkey, also stated that their companies, which hold a 34 percent share of the world market in the production of ice cream machines, will increase their capacity and increase their growth figures to higher levels in the coming years. Emphasizing that Gram Equipment Turkey is currently able to manufacture more than 20 different types of machines specially designed for the customer, Seyhan said: “We design, manufacture, test and commission all medium speed machines with our local teams. We mostly procure stainless parts, which are the main inputs of ice cream machines, from local suppliers. Since our establishment, we have produced more than 49 individual machines, 400 full lines and 42 partial lines for 31 countries.”
